WebCurrent with changes from the 2024 Legislative Session through Ch. 776, effective on or before 7/1/2024. Section 5-310 - Revocations. (a) The Secretary may revoke a permit on a finding that the holder: (1) does not meet the qualifications described in § 5-306 of this subtitle; or. (2) violated § 5-308 of this subtitle.
